2FN6

Helicobacter pylori PseC, aminotransferase involved in the biosynthesis of pseudoaminic acid

Summary for 2FN6
Entry DOI10.2210/pdb2fn6/pdb
DescriptorAMINOTRANSFERASE, PHOSPHATE ION (3 entities in total)
Functional Keywordsaminotransferase, pseudoaminic acid biosynthesis, flagellar modification, structural genomics, montreal-kingston bacterial structural genomics initiative, bsgi, transferase
Biological sourceHelicobacter pylori
Total number of polymer chains2
Total formula weight85107.32
Authors
Cygler, M.,Lunin, V.V.,Matte, A.,Montreal-Kingston Bacterial Structural Genomics Initiative (BSGI) (deposition date: 2006-01-10, release date: 2006-01-24, Last modification date: 2023-08-30)
Primary citationSchoenhofen, I.C.,Lunin, V.V.,Julien, J.P.,Li, Y.,Ajamian, E.,Matte, A.,Cygler, M.,Brisson, J.R.,Aubry, A.,Logan, S.M.,Bhatia, S.,Wakarchuk, W.W.,Young, N.M.
Structural and Functional Characterization of PseC, an Aminotransferase Involved in the Biosynthesis of Pseudaminic Acid, an Essential Flagellar Modification in Helicobacter pylori
J.Biol.Chem., 281:8907-8916, 2006
